Abstract :
This paper presents an analysis of losses of a high frequency link located inside the nacelle of wind turbines that will allow series connection offshore. The conversion system is based on a reduced matrix converter operated as a voltage source. Reverse blocking IGBTs are required for the operation and at the same time allowed for reduction of losses. Two carrier based switching strategies and a modified space vector modulation are implemented and discussed. Losses are calculated analytically and by simulation. A behavioral switching model of each IGBT is used. Results are conclusive about the superior performance of the proposed topology from the point of view of the losses.
